Geneva, July 7 -- International Clinical Trials Registry received information related to the study (ACTRN12626000764336) titled 'Repeated Low-level Red-Light Therapy in high myopes (8-16 years)' on June 26.

Study Type: Interventional

Study Design: Purpose: Treatment Allocation: Randomised controlled trial Masking: Blinded (masking used) Assignment: Parallel

Primary Sponsor: University of Canberra

Condition: high myopia high myopia Eye - Diseases / disorders of the eye

Intervention: Light therapy using a semiconductor laser diode emitting low-level red light at a wavelength of 650 ± 10 nm, with an illuminance of 1600 lux and a light intensity of 0.290 mW. Intervention: RLRL standard energy emission 3 minutes once daily, 5 days...
